check_format: For C files only, fix return type breaks
In SPDK, declarations have the return type on the same line. Definitions have the return type on a separate line. Astyle has an option for enforcing this. Unfortunately, it seems to have two bugs:
1) It doesn't work correctly at all on C++ files. 2) It often fails on functions that return enums, or long type names
Deal with 1) by adjusting the check_format.sh script to only tell astyle to fix return type line breaks for C files and not C++. Deal with 2) by adding a few typedefs to work around the problem.

Replace most BSD 3-clause license text with SPDX identifier.
Many open source projects have moved to using SPDX identifiers to specify license information, reducing the amount of boilerplate code in every source file. This patch replaces the bulk of SPDK .c, .cpp and Makefiles with the BSD-3-Clause identifier.
Almost all of these files share the exact same license text, and this patch only modifies the files that contain the most common license text. There can be slight variations because the third clause contains company names - most say "Intel Corporation", but there are instances for Nvidia, Samsung, Eideticom and even "the copyright holder".
Used a bash script to automate replacement of the license text with SPDX identifier which is checked into scripts/spdx.sh.
